Absolutely, using FSR (FidelityFX Super Resolution) on your Steam Deck can be a game changer! It enhances the visuals of your games while giving you smoother performance. Essentially, FSR adjusts the game resolution to boost fps without a noticeable loss in quality. Especially on a portable device like the Steam Deck, where you want to balance visuals with performance, it's a no-brainer. Give it a shot and see how your favorite games play!
